Overview of Marina di Olbia, Italy

Marina di Olbia, nestled in the deep inlet of Olbia on the northern coast of Sardinia, offers a perfect blend of natural beauty, cultural richness, and exceptional marine services, making it a premier location for yacht fuel services and marine fuel bunkering. The marina’s extensive facilities, including the largest marine fuel berth on Sardinia's northern coast, are designed to accommodate vessels up to 150 metres long with the capacity to fuel up to seven yachts simultaneously, ensuring efficiency and safety for all visiting vessels.

Landscape

The natural landscape surrounding Marina di Olbia is characterized by a breathtaking blend of rugged coastline, crystal-clear turquoise waters, and rolling hills dotted with Mediterranean vegetation. The marina lies within a sheltered deep fiord, offering calm and protected waters ideal for mooring. The climate is Mediterranean, with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ters, creating nearly year-round boating opportunities. Spring and summer burst with vibrant colors and warm temperatures, perfect for enjoying sailing and water activities, while autumn and winter provide a quieter, cooler atmosphere favored by those seeking tranquility amid nature’s serene beauty. Nearby outdoor treasures include the expansive beaches and nature parks around Sardinia, offering hiking, birdwatching, and scenic walks for crew looking to explore beyond the marina.

Culture

Olbia is steeped in a rich cultural heritage shaped by its role as a historical gateway to Sardinia. The town originally rose as an important Roman trading port, which deeply influences its cultural fabric today. Local traditions emphasize Sardinian hospitality, distinctive culinary traditions, and the preservation of folklore. Annual festivals, such as the Festa di San Simplicio, celebrate the town’s patron saint with processions, music, and traditional Sardinian costumes, offering an immersive cultural experience for visitors. The lively markets and artisan shops reflect a community proud of its identity and eager to share authentic Sardinian crafts and cuisine.

Famous Landmarks

Visitors to Olbia can enjoy several historical and architectural highlights:

  • Basilica of San Simplicio – A magnificent Romanesque church dating back to the 11th century, renowned for its elegant stone architecture and serene ambiance, representing Olbia’s medieval religious heritage.
  • Castello di Pedres – Ancient ruins of a Nuragic fortress perched on a hill, offering panoramic views and insight into the prehistoric civilizations of Sardinia.
  • Archaeological Museum of Olbia – A treasure trove of artifacts that narrate the history of the town from its Punic and Roman roots to modern times, perfect for those interested in the region’s deep historical tapestry.

Activities for Crew Members

The vibrant town of Olbia and its surroundings offer a variety of activities catering to yacht crews and visitors seeking both relaxation and adventure. The marina itself provides convenient access to shopping centers, bars, bistros, and restaurants that stay open year-round, offering delicious Sardinian cuisine featuring fresh seafood, local cheeses, and wines. Cultural outings to museums and archaeological sites stimulate a deeper appreciation of the island’s rich past.

For outdoor enthusiasts, boat excursions along the stunning Sardinian coast, snorkeling in crystal-clear waters, and exploring nearby islands and beaches are popular. The marina’s free shuttle service allows quick access to the city center, airport, and ferry terminals, facilitating excursions or restocking supplies effortlessly.
